Construction at Risk

Construction at Risk

Construction at Risk, often referred to as Construction Management at Risk (CMAR), is a project delivery method where a construction manager commits to delivering a project within a Guaranteed Maximum Price (GMP). This approach shifts significant financial risk from the owner to the construction manager, fostering a collaborative environment from the project's inception. It is particularly valuable for homeowners undertaking complex custom builds, extensive renovations, or multi-unit residential projects, offering greater cost certainty and streamlined project execution. Understanding CMAR is crucial for making informed decisions about project delivery, ensuring budget control, and achieving desired quality outcomes within the broader context of home improvement and construction management.

What is Construction at Risk?

Construction at Risk, most commonly embodied by the Construction Management at Risk (CMAR) delivery method, is a contractual arrangement where a construction manager (CM) acts as a consultant to the owner during the design phase and then as the general contractor during the construction phase. A defining characteristic of CMAR is the commitment by the CM to deliver the project for a Guaranteed Maximum Price (GMP), thereby assuming the financial risk for any costs exceeding this agreed-upon ceiling, barring owner-initiated changes or unforeseen conditions explicitly excluded from the GMP.

This method emerged as an evolution from traditional Design-Bid-Build approaches, which often led to adversarial relationships between designers, owners, and contractors, as well as frequent cost overruns and schedule delays. The history of CMAR reflects a desire for greater collaboration, transparency, and accountability in complex construction projects. It gained prominence in the late 20th century as projects became more intricate and owners sought more predictable outcomes.

The primary purpose of Construction at Risk is to provide owners with a higher degree of cost and schedule certainty early in the project lifecycle. By involving the construction manager during the design phase, their practical construction expertise can be leveraged to inform design decisions, identify potential constructability issues, and optimize material selections. This early involvement, known as pre-construction services, is critical for value engineering and accurate cost estimation, ultimately leading to a more efficient and cost-effective project.

For homeowners, particularly those embarking on significant custom home builds, large-scale additions, or complex renovations, understanding CMAR is of paramount importance. It offers an alternative to the traditional general contractor model, where the owner often bears more risk for cost fluctuations. With CMAR, the construction manager is incentivized to manage costs effectively because they are responsible for any overruns beyond the GMP. This aligns the CM's interests with the owner's, fostering a partnership approach rather than a purely transactional one.

Construction at Risk fits within the wider knowledge graph of project delivery methods, alongside Design-Bid-Build and Design-Build. While Design-Bid-Build separates design and construction, and Design-Build integrates them under a single entity, CMAR offers a hybrid model. It maintains separate design and construction contracts but brings the construction expertise into the design process. This distinction is crucial for owners to select the method that best suits their project's complexity, risk tolerance, and desired level of involvement.

The importance of CMAR extends beyond just cost control. It promotes better communication, reduces the likelihood of disputes, and often results in higher quality outcomes due to the collaborative problem-solving inherent in the process. The construction manager's early input can help prevent costly redesigns or construction errors, ensuring that the project aligns with the owner's vision and budget from the outset. It is a sophisticated approach to Construction Management that prioritizes proactive risk mitigation and integrated project delivery.

How It Works

The Construction at Risk (CMAR) process typically unfolds in two main phases: pre-construction and construction. This structured workflow ensures that potential issues are addressed early, and the project benefits from integrated expertise.

Pre-Construction Phase

During this initial phase, the owner contracts with a Construction Manager at Risk (CMAR) firm. Unlike a traditional general contractor who is brought in after designs are complete, the CMAR is engaged early, often concurrently with the architect or designer. The CMAR's role here is advisory, providing critical input on:

  • Cost Estimation: Developing detailed cost models and budgets as the design progresses, offering realistic projections.
  • Value Engineering: Collaborating with the design team to identify alternative materials, systems, or construction methods that can reduce costs without compromising quality or functionality. This is a key benefit for Budgeting (Construction).
  • Scheduling: Creating comprehensive project schedules, identifying critical path activities, and optimizing timelines.
  • Constructability Reviews: Analyzing design documents to ensure they are practical, efficient, and free of potential construction challenges.
  • Risk Assessment: Identifying potential risks related to site conditions, materials, labor, or regulatory compliance, and developing mitigation strategies.
  • Subcontractor Prequalification: Assisting the owner in vetting and selecting qualified subcontractors.

This collaborative period culminates in the CMAR proposing a Guaranteed Maximum Price (GMP) for the project. The GMP is a firm commitment from the CMAR that the total cost of construction will not exceed this amount, provided the scope remains as defined. This price is typically based on a well-developed set of design documents (often 60-90% complete) and includes the CMAR's fee, general conditions, and a contingency for unforeseen issues within their scope.

Construction Phase

Once the GMP is agreed upon and the design is finalized, the CMAR transitions into the role of the General Contractor. They then manage all aspects of the physical construction, including:

  • Subcontractor Management: Soliciting bids from prequalified subcontractors, awarding contracts, and overseeing their work. The CMAR often uses an "open book" approach, allowing the owner to see all subcontractor bids and costs.
  • Project Management: Overseeing daily operations, ensuring adherence to the schedule, budget, and quality standards. This involves robust Project Management (Construction) practices.
  • Quality Control: Implementing measures to ensure that all work meets specified standards and building codes.
  • Safety Management: Maintaining a safe work environment in accordance with all regulations.
  • Cost Control: Actively managing project expenditures to stay within the GMP. Any savings achieved below the GMP are typically shared between the owner and the CMAR, as defined in the contract.
  • Change Order Management: Processing and negotiating any necessary changes to the project scope, which would adjust the GMP accordingly.

Throughout both phases, communication and transparency are paramount. The CMAR provides regular reports to the owner on progress, costs, and any potential issues, ensuring the owner is fully informed and involved in key decisions. This integrated approach aims to deliver a high-quality project efficiently and within a predictable budget.

Key Concepts

Guaranteed Maximum Price (GMP)

The GMP is a cornerstone of Construction at Risk. It is the maximum cost the owner will pay for the project, excluding owner-directed changes. The CMAR assumes responsibility for any costs exceeding this amount. This provides the owner with significant cost certainty and incentivizes the CMAR to manage the budget diligently.

Pre-Construction Services

These are the advisory services provided by the CMAR during the design phase. They include cost estimating, scheduling, constructability reviews, value engineering, and risk assessment. Early involvement of construction expertise helps optimize the design for efficiency, cost-effectiveness, and buildability before physical work begins.

Value Engineering

A systematic process, often conducted during pre-construction, to analyze project functions and identify alternative solutions that achieve the same performance at a lower cost or with improved value. The CMAR's input is invaluable here, suggesting materials or methods that maintain quality while reducing overall project expenses.

Open Book Accounting

This principle dictates that the CMAR provides the owner with full transparency regarding all project costs, including subcontractor bids, material purchases, and labor expenses. This fosters trust and allows the owner to verify that costs are fair and reasonable, reinforcing the collaborative nature of the CMAR relationship.

Contingency

A sum of money included in the project budget to cover unforeseen costs or scope changes. In a CMAR contract, there's often an owner's contingency and a CMAR's contingency. The CMAR's contingency covers risks they assume under the GMP, while the owner's contingency covers owner-directed changes or risks explicitly excluded from the GMP.

Risk Allocation

A fundamental aspect of any construction contract, defining which party is responsible for specific project risks (e.g., cost overruns, schedule delays, design errors). In CMAR, the GMP shifts a significant portion of cost risk to the CMAR, promoting proactive risk management and mitigation strategies.

Early Contractor Involvement (ECI)

This refers to bringing the construction manager or contractor into the project team during the early design stages. ECI is a core benefit of CMAR, allowing practical construction knowledge to influence design decisions, improve constructability, and enhance cost predictability before construction even begins.

Practical Considerations

Benefits

  • Cost Certainty: The Guaranteed Maximum Price (GMP) provides owners with a clear upper limit on project costs, making Budgeting (Construction) more predictable.
  • Early Contractor Involvement: The CMAR's expertise during design leads to better constructability, value engineering, and fewer design errors, potentially saving time and money.
  • Improved Collaboration: Fosters a team-oriented approach between the owner, designer, and CMAR, reducing adversarial relationships common in other delivery methods.
  • Reduced Change Orders: Thorough pre-construction planning and constructability reviews minimize unforeseen issues during construction, leading to fewer costly change orders.
  • Faster Project Delivery: Overlapping design and construction phases (fast-tracking) can accelerate the overall project schedule, though this requires careful management.
  • Higher Quality: The CMAR's early input can help ensure that design decisions are practical and lead to a high-quality finished product.

Limitations

  • Higher Initial Fees: CMAR services, especially pre-construction, can have higher upfront costs compared to simply bidding out a fully designed project.
  • Requires Experienced CMAR: The success of a CMAR project heavily relies on the expertise, integrity, and collaborative spirit of the chosen construction manager.
  • Less Competitive Bidding: While subcontractors are typically competitively bid, the overall CMAR fee and general conditions are negotiated, which might not be as competitive as a full Design-Bid-Build scenario.
  • Scope Definition Critical: The GMP is only as good as the clarity of the project scope at the time it's established. Ambiguities can lead to disputes or increased costs.
  • Owner Involvement: This method often requires more active owner involvement during the design and pre-construction phases, which may not suit all owners.

Common Mistakes

  • Inadequate Scope Definition: Establishing a GMP without a sufficiently detailed scope can lead to misunderstandings, disputes, and cost escalations later.
  • Choosing the Wrong CMAR: Selecting a CMAR based solely on price rather than experience, reputation, and a proven track record of collaboration can undermine the project's success.
  • Lack of Owner Engagement: Failing to actively participate in design reviews and decision-making during pre-construction can negate the benefits of early contractor involvement.
  • Insufficient Contingency: Not allocating adequate contingency funds for owner-directed changes or truly unforeseen conditions can strain the budget.
  • Poor Communication: A breakdown in communication between the owner, designer, and CMAR can lead to errors, delays, and a loss of trust.

Best Practices

  • Thorough CMAR Selection: Vet potential CMARs based on their experience with similar projects, their team's expertise, references, and their approach to collaboration and transparency.
  • Clear Contract Documentation: Ensure the contract clearly defines roles, responsibilities, scope, GMP inclusions/exclusions, contingency usage, and dispute resolution mechanisms.
  • Robust Pre-Construction Phase: Invest sufficient time and resources in detailed cost estimating, value engineering, and constructability reviews before setting the GMP.
  • Maintain Open Communication: Establish regular meetings and clear communication channels among all project stakeholders (owner, designer, CMAR).
  • Active Owner Participation: Remain engaged throughout the design and pre-construction phases, providing timely feedback and decisions.
  • Transparent Cost Reporting: Insist on open book accounting from the CMAR to ensure all costs are verifiable and fair.

Real-world Examples

Construction at Risk is frequently employed in projects where complexity, budget predictability, and schedule are critical. For homeowners, this might include:

  • Large-Scale Custom Homes: When building a unique, architecturally complex home, a CMAR can help manage intricate designs, specialized materials, and tight budgets from the outset.
  • Extensive Home Renovations or Additions: Projects involving significant structural changes, integration of new and old systems (e.g., HVAC Systems, Electrical Systems), or challenging site conditions benefit from the CMAR's early planning and risk mitigation.
  • Multi-Unit Residential Developments: For owners developing small apartment buildings or townhome complexes, CMAR offers a way to control costs and schedules across multiple units while ensuring quality.
  • Sustainable or Green Buildings: Projects aiming for specific certifications like Passive House or Net Zero Energy often require specialized knowledge and integrated design-construction planning, making CMAR an ideal fit.

Frequently Asked Questions

Q: What is the main difference between CMAR and a traditional General Contractor?
A: A CMAR is involved during the design phase, providing cost and constructability input, and commits to a Guaranteed Maximum Price (GMP). A traditional General Contractor is typically hired after the design is complete and bids on the finished plans.

Q: Does CMAR always guarantee the lowest price?
A: Not necessarily the lowest, but it aims for the most predictable and controlled price. The GMP provides certainty, and value engineering during pre-construction helps optimize costs without sacrificing quality.

Q: What happens if the project costs go over the GMP?
A: If costs exceed the GMP due to factors within the CMAR's control, the CMAR is responsible for covering the overage. If due to owner-directed changes or explicitly excluded unforeseen conditions, the GMP may be adjusted.

Q: Can I still choose my own architect or designer with CMAR?
A: Yes, the owner typically contracts separately with the architect/designer. The CMAR then collaborates closely with the design team during the pre-construction phase.

Q: Is CMAR suitable for small home improvement projects?
A: CMAR is generally more suited for larger, more complex projects where the benefits of early contractor involvement and cost certainty outweigh the potentially higher initial fees. For smaller projects, a traditional contractor might be more appropriate.

Q: How are cost savings handled in a CMAR contract?
A: If the project is completed under the GMP, the savings are typically shared between the owner and the CMAR according to a pre-agreed percentage outlined in the contract.
